The Importance of Employee Happiness in Today's Workplace
Employee happiness has become a central theme in contemporary management practices, revealing its critical impact on productivity and organizational success. In today’s competitive business environment, where the "quiet quitting" movement has highlighted widespread dissatisfaction, understanding how to foster a positive work atmosphere is more vital than ever. The data are revealing: employee engagement in the United States has hit a ten-year low, with only 32% feeling engaged at their jobs. This stark statistic urges employers to adopt strategies that elevate employee happiness, leading to greater retention, productivity, and overall business success.
Benefits of Creating a Supportive Work Environment
Creating a supportive workplace doesn't have to be cost-prohibitive; in fact, many companies are discovering that simple, thoughtful approaches significantly enhance employee morale without breaking the bank. For instance, offering flexible work schedules allows employees to manage their responsibilities in a way that suits their lifestyles, fostering a sense of autonomy that directly contributes to job satisfaction. Allowing remote working options has similarly proven effective, demonstrating trust in employees and providing them the work-life balance they crave.
Practical Steps to Enhance Employee Well-Being
To cultivate a happier workforce, businesses can implement several straightforward strategies:
- Encourage Autonomy: Permit employees to tailor their roles and schedules to better fit personal working styles.
- Support Mental Health: Offering resources like telehealth services and mental health days can show employees that their well-being is a priority.
- Recognize Contributions: Celebrating achievements, be it through shoutouts or small tokens of appreciation, fosters a culture of recognition.
- Promote Professional Development: Providing access to mentorship programs and workshops empowers employees and encourages their growth.
Why These Practices Matter
Implementing these approaches leads not only to happier employees but also to strong financial performance. Research shows that engaged employees contribute to twice the revenue growth and profit margins compared to their disengaged counterparts. This undeniable link establishes employee happiness as a crucial driver for business success.
